kalamine:一款跨平台键盘布局制作工具
kalamine Keyboard Layout Maker 项目地址: https://gitcode.com/gh_mirrors/ka/kalamine
在现代计算机使用中,键盘布局的个性化和定制化越来越受到用户的重视。kalamine正是一款能够满足这一需求的强大工具。本文将详细介绍kalamine的核心功能、技术背景、应用场景和项目特点,帮助读者全面了解并有效利用这一开源项目。
项目介绍
kalamine是一款基于文本的跨平台键盘布局制作工具。它允许用户通过简单的配置文件,创建和定制自己的键盘布局。kalamine支持生成多种平台下的键盘驱动文件,包括Windows、macOS和Linux系统,能够满足不同用户的需求。
项目技术分析
kalamine使用Python 3.8+环境,并且可以通过pip或pipx进行安装、升级和卸载。它的设计理念是简单直观,用户可以通过编辑配置文件来定义键盘布局,然后通过命令行工具生成特定平台的键盘驱动文件。
项目的技术架构主要包括以下几个方面:
- 配置文件解析:kalamine使用TOML格式的配置文件,用户可以在这个文件中定义键盘的键位和功能。
- 跨平台支持:通过不同的编译脚本和工具,kalamine可以为Windows、macOS和Linux系统生成相应的键盘驱动文件。
- 实时预览:kalamine提供了实时预览功能,用户可以在浏览器中实时查看和测试键盘布局的效果。
项目技术应用场景
kalamine的应用场景非常广泛,以下是一些典型的使用案例:
- 个性化键盘布局:用户可以根据自己的打字习惯和需求,定制个性化的键盘布局。
- 特殊语言支持:对于一些特殊语言或符号,kalamine可以帮助用户创建专门的键盘布局,方便输入。
- 辅助工具:对于一些有特殊需求的用户,例如编程、设计等,kalamine可以定制适合特定工作的键盘布局。
项目特点
kalamine具有以下显著特点:
- 跨平台:kalamine支持Windows、macOS和Linux系统,用户可以在不同的操作系统上使用。
- 简单易用:用户通过编辑TOML格式的配置文件即可定制键盘布局,无需复杂的编程知识。
- 实时预览:通过浏览器实时预览键盘布局,方便用户测试和调整。
- 多语言支持:kalamine支持多种语言的键盘布局,满足不同用户的需求。
总结来说,kalamine是一款功能强大、使用简便的键盘布局制作工具。无论是普通用户还是专业用户,都可以通过kalamine轻松创建和定制适合自己的键盘布局,提升工作和学习效率。
为了确保本文符合SEO收录规则,以下是一些关键点:
- 文章标题包含项目名称“kalamine”,并且简洁明了。
- 文章内容详细介绍了项目的核心功能、技术分析、应用场景和特点。
- 文章中多次出现项目名称和相关关键词,如“键盘布局制作工具”、“跨平台”、“个性化键盘布局”等。
- 文章内容结构清晰,有助于搜索引擎抓取和理解。
通过以上措施,本文将有效地吸引用户关注和使用kalamine开源项目。
kalamine Keyboard Layout Maker 项目地址: https://gitcode.com/gh_mirrors/ka/kalamine
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考